Police Constable Recruitment Process to Resume from December 8 in Bilaspur

Police

Bilaspur: Following the removal of a stay by the High Court of Bilaspur, the Police Constable Recruitment process will recommence from December 8, 2024. The recruitment pertains to vacancies in the District Police Force Constable Cadre for 2023-24 within the Bilaspur Range (Centre No. 01).

Recruitment Process Details The recruitment, originally scheduled to begin on November 16, 2024, at the Second Battalion, Chhattisgarh Armed Forces (CAF), Sakri, Bilaspur, was halted on November 27 following directives from the High Court. With the court's final decision now in place, the process is set to resume.

Important Instructions for Candidates

Reporting Date and Venue: Candidates issued admit cards for December 8 must report to the Second Battalion, CAF, Sakri, District Bilaspur.

Required Documents: A print copy of the online application form. Original certificates and self-attested photocopies. Admit card. Valid ID proof.

Pending Candidates: Candidates whose recruitment process was scheduled between November 27 and December 7 will receive new dates and admit cards separately. Such candidates must appear at the recruitment center on the rescheduled date mentioned in their revised admit card.

Key Recruitment Activities

The process will include:

Document Verification.

Physical Measurements.

Physical Efficiency Tests.

Candidates are advised to strictly adhere to the instructions mentioned in their admit cards and carry all necessary documents to avoid disqualification. This recruitment process is crucial for filling vacancies within the Bilaspur range and ensuring the district police force operates at full capacity.
